The Psychology of Winning and Near Misses
One of the key factors behind the addictive nature of online gambling is how wins (and almost-wins) make players feel. When players hit a win or get close to one, their brains release dopamine—the same chemical responsible for feelings of pleasure. This creates a rewarding sensation that players want to experience again and again.
- The Dopamine Hit: Winning feels good, and that rush of dopamine keeps players engaged. Even small wins trigger this effect, keeping players hooked.
- The Near-Miss Effect: When players get close to a win but fall just short, their brains treat it as if they almost succeeded, encouraging them to try again. This effect is particularly powerful in games like slots, where near-misses happen frequently.
- Variable Rewards: The unpredictable nature of gambling rewards makes it even more addictive. Players never know when the next win will come, which keeps them engaged and hoping for a big payout.

Responsible Gambling: Staying in Control
While online gambling can be fun, it’s essential to stay in control. Many platforms now offer tools to help players manage their gaming habits, including deposit limits, time reminders, and self-exclusion options.
- Setting Limits: Most online casinos allow players to set deposit, loss, and time limits, helping them stay within a budget and manage playtime responsibly.
- Self-Exclusion: If gambling becomes overwhelming, self-exclusion options allow players to take a break from the platform temporarily or permanently.
- Educational Resources: Many platforms offer resources that educate players on responsible gambling and provide support for those who may be struggling.
